Readers find 'Petit Pays' deeply moving, portraying the harsh realities of war through the innocent eyes of a young boy, Gabriel. The narrative beautifully juxtaposes a serene childhood against the backdrop of the Rwandan genocide and Burundian civil war, making it a poignant exploration of lost innocence and the brutal impact of ethnic conflicts. The book's emotional depth and the vivid portrayal of a turbulent historical period have resonated strongly, leaving many readers profoundly affected and reflective.
